Violet to your ears I slowly watch my heart pierce itself to your skin engraved into your passions each word, each action, each thought within every hand motion, every verb. Your daily stance I've seen myself inside of your hands & I felt so home So comfortable. The though of me never being alone was merely touchable it made my temple sing the blues a saxophone blowing in you Ricocheting my melody It's violet to my ears rose water his love fell on me now his garden is all I want to hear
